Sodium polystyrene sulfonate resin is a synthetic, insoluble polymer cation-exchange resin that binds potassium ions in the gastrointestinal tract in exchange for sodium ions, thereby promoting the elimination of excess potassium through the feces. It is primarily used for the treatment of hyperkalemia (elevated blood potassium). It is not a biological macromolecule, receptor, enzyme, transporter, or classical drug target, but a pharmacologically active polymer *drug* that acts through a physicochemical mechanism. Known side effects range from mild gastrointestinal symptoms to rare but serious intestinal necrosis[3][5][7].\n\nClarification: *Sodium polystyrene sulfonate resin* is a therapeutic agent, not a molecular "target" such as a protein, receptor, enzyme, or nucleic acid.
